Conditions

older patients with preoperative frailty

Interventions

control group:to investigate the MAC-awake of sevoflurane in patients with normal patients
preoperative weakness group:to investigate the MAC-awake of sevoflurane in patients with frailty.

Eligibility

Sex/Gender
All
Age
65 Years to 90 Years

Inclusion criteria

Inclusion criteria: 1. Patients who plan to undergo non-cardiac elective surgery under general anesthesia; 2. Over 65 years old; 3. ASA: Grade?-?; 4. Body weight is 40-80kg

Exclusion criteria

Exclusion criteria: 1. heart failure, severe arrhythmia, with serious liver and kidney diseases; 2. Preoperative neuropsychiatric diseases (including schizophrenia, depression, and mania); 3. Unable to complete the scale examination (due to dementia, deafness or language impairment); 4. Cerebrovascular accident (stroke, transient ischemic attack) within 3 months; 5. History of drug abuse and blood coagulation dysfunction; 6. No informed consent form was signed.
